About this tag
The tag 'centralized hub' on WindowsForum.com covers discussions about Microsoft's efforts to create unified launchers and management interfaces within Windows. A key example is the Xbox app's new 'My apps' tab, which allows Xbox Insiders to install, launch, and manage third-party apps and storefronts from a single controller-friendly interface, particularly for handheld gaming devices. This reflects Microsoft's strategy to reposition the Xbox app as a centralized hub for PC gaming, consolidating access to games and apps across different sources. The tag focuses on how Windows and Xbox software evolve to provide integrated, streamlined experiences for users.
-
Xbox App: My Apps Tab - A Unified Launcher for PC Handheld Gaming
Microsoft has begun testing a new “My apps” tab inside the Xbox app for Windows 11 that lets Xbox Insiders install, launch and — in some cases — download third‑party apps and rival storefronts from a single, controller‑friendly launcher designed especially for handheld Windows gaming devices...- ChatGPT
- Thread
- anti-cheat app aggregator battle.net centralized hub controller gaming gog galaxy handheld gaming launcher my apps pc gaming preview privacy security third-party stores windows 11 xbox app xbox insiders
- Replies: 0
- Forum: Windows News